Package: trousers Version: 0.3.1-3 tcsd doesn't create a pidfile, so the init script fails to stop it when told to. Moreover, the init script uses --oknodo to start-stop-daemon so you don't know that it hasn't been shutdown.
Please use --background and --make-pidfile with -f to tcsd to make it not fork and get a pidfile for it in start, and remove the --oknodo in stop. Thanks, David Smith -- man perl | tail -6 | head -2
